For all engineering work, it is required to know beforehand the probable cost of construction known as “Estimated cost”. If the estimated cost is greater than the money available, then attempts are made to reduce the cost by reducing the work or by changing the specifications. In preparing an estimate, the quantities of different items of work are calculated by simple measurement methods and from these quantities the cost is calculated. This course is designed to provide the basics of estimating and costing of various construction projects such as buildings, roads, water supply systems, dams, airports and other related civil engineering structures. It covers determination of unit rates for labour, construction materials, construction plant & equipment and possible forecasting of future construction rates. It consists of determining the cost of various items in the structure and calculate the overall cost of the structure.
